Giant Lawn ScrabbleTransforming a classic word game into a backyard spectacle breathes new life into sunny afternoons. Giant lawn Scrabble scales up the traditional board game into a tactile, strategic experience. Hobbyists can craft tiles from square pieces of plywood, sanding the edges smooth and stenciling point values onto each letter. The game grid is mapped out directly onto the grass using water-based marking spray or durable string lines anchored by camping stakes.Playing this oversized version introduces a delightful physical element to the mental challenge. Instead of sitting quietly at a table, participants carry large tiles across the lawn, visually mapping out anagrams on a grand scale. The open-air setting naturally invites spectators to cheer on clever word placements or lightheartedly debate obscure vocabulary. It turns a solitary intellectual pursuit into a highly social, visually striking centerpiece for any weekend gathering.

Backyard KerplunkReliving childhood nostalgia takes a thrilling turn with a life-sized iteration of backyard Kerplunk. This towering game requires a cylindrical cage crafted from wire fencing, suspended slightly above the ground on a sturdy wooden frame. Dozens of brightly colored plastic ball pit spheres sit precariously at the top, held aloft by a lattice of thin bamboo stakes threaded through the wire mesh. The structural scale alone guarantees it will draw a curious crowd.Players take turns carefully withdrawing a single bamboo stake, trying desperately not to trigger an avalanche of colorful spheres. The tension builds with every successful removal as the remaining support structure weakens. The satisfying, chaotic clatter of plastic balls raining down onto the grass signals defeat for one player and triumph for the rest. This game combines suspense, hand-eye coordination, and a massive dose of whimsical energy perfect for casual hobbyists.

Flamingo Ring TossStandard ring toss gets a vibrant, tropical upgrade by swapping out simple wooden pegs for iconic pink plastic lawn flamingos. This quirky adaptation instantly injects a sense of mid-century Americana kitsch into any backyard event. The flamingos are staked firmly into the turf at varying distances and angles to establish a tiered difficulty system. Closer birds offer fewer points, while distant or awkwardly angled flamingos challenge even the most precise throwers.Instead of traditional heavy rings, players toss brightly colored diving rings or lightweight glow-in-the-dark necklaces for evening play. The slender, curved necks of the plastic flamingos serve as the perfect targets, making a successful ringer incredibly satisfying. The visual appeal of neon pink birds scattered across a lush green lawn adds an instant festive atmosphere, ensuring that this game is as much a decorative statement as it is a competitive pastime.

Glow-in-the-Dark Human FoosballWhen the sun sets, the hobbyist’s lawn transforms into a glowing sports arena with human foosball. This highly energetic game replicates the classic tabletop soccer experience on a human scale. A rectangular court is outlined using glowing LED ropes or fluorescent tape. Long PVC pipes or thick ropes stretch across the playing field, serving as the rods. Players grip these bars and are restricted to moving only left or right, exactly like their miniature plastic counterparts.To maximize the nighttime effect, participants wear neon pinnies, and a glowing, lightweight soccer ball serves as the game piece. The restricted lateral movement forces teams to communicate constantly and pass rhythmically to advance the ball toward the opponent’s goal. It eliminates the traditional running of soccer, replacing it with a hilarious, synchronized dance of side-shuffling and precise kicking that keeps players and onlookers laughing late into the night.

Oversized Matchbox Racing LanesDie-cast toy car racing is no longer confined to the living room floor. Creative hobbyists can construct massive, multi-lane downhill racetracks directly on natural backyard slopes. Long strips of flexible plastic gutter guards or smooth wooden planks serve as the highway lanes, secured to the hillside with metal landscaping staples. A custom-built wooden starting gate with a mechanical release lever ensures a perfectly fair start for every miniature vehicle.Participants bring their favorite childhood toy cars or custom-tuned models to compete in high-speed tournament brackets. Gravity does all the work as the cars hurtle down the grassy slope, navigating slight bumps and curves toward a defined finish line. This unique lawn game appeals deeply to the collector’s spirit, merging the joy of model tuning with the thrill of outdoor spectator sports.

The Ultimate Backyard Obstacle CourseDesigning an unconventional obstacle course allows hobbyists to curate a truly bespoke lawn game experience. Rather than relying on standard athletic drills, a quirky course utilizes everyday household items in unexpected ways. A typical layout might require participants to balance a heavy water balloon on a frying pan while weaving through a maze of lawn chairs, followed by a frantic crawl under a low-hung tarp sprayed with water.The beauty of this setup lies entirely in its endless capacity for customization and themes. Creative builders can introduce elements like a blindfolded navigation zone guided only by a teammate’s voice, or a final station where players must successfully land a beanbag into a spinning hula hoop. The combination of physical agility, balance, and pure absurdity ensures that every run through the course is unpredictable, memorable, and immensely entertaining for everyone involved.
